Question:

Do you have to have two sub pre amp out puts or just two plain preamp outputs to hook up multilple subs ?

  2. that all depends on your amps and if you have a decent deck

    but in general all you need is a rear line out from deck and if your using two amps on the four subs use the pass through to send signal too the other amp.

    but in all reality the total lack of control over the signal sucks

    if your lucky you have at least one amp with a remote k**b for gain and boost amount control so it would be fine to use just a plain old rear line out from the deck just remember to set the crossover on the amp to lowpass.   oh i amost forgot the make these little splitters for rca's but they cut down on the signal so not always a good option
